2 Executive Summary Both Citrix and VMware have solid products and product visions to realize enterprise virtualization goals. Over 75% of organization don’t consider vendors outside of VMware and Citrix for desktop virtualization. Build your VDI product shortlist. Citrix and VMware are the leaders; however, there are other players that can be considered. The vendor landscape is changing as secondary players are swept up in various mergers and acquisitions. While deploying VDI, aim for your overall budget to be less than, and at worst the same as, refreshing with traditional desktop infrastructure. Ensure, before making any decisions, to consider all costs including implementation, energy savings, desk side support, and application and desktop maintenance. Info-Tech Research Group
